{en} The Deliverance of God: An Apocalyptic Rereading of Justification in Paul (2009) is a book by Douglas A. Campbell.

< Available at U-M >

Abstract

"This book breaks a significant impasse in much Pauline interpretation, pushing beyond both "Lutheran" and "New" perspectives on Paul to a non-contractual, "apocalyptic" reading of many of the apostle's most famous, and most troublesome, texts. His strongly antithetical vision identifies "participation in Christ" as the sole core of Pauline theology and produces the most radical rereading of Romans 1-4 for more than a generation. Even those who disagree will be forced to clarify their views as never before."--Publisher description.
